Description

An exciting opportunity to purchase a handsome three bedroom, double fronted semi-detached house located in the heart of the desirable village of Lazonby. Tucked away behind the village school this impressive property not only offers ample space inside but also a huge rear garden, beautiful views, parking and a garage. This property would make a wonderful family home and would appeal to those looking to put their own stamp on a great home. With spacious and characterful accommodation throughout in brief the property comprises porch, entrance hall, lounge, dining room, kitchen, utility room and store room with access to the garage. Upstairs there are three double bedrooms and a spacious four piece family bathroom. Outside the property occupies a wonderful plot with a pretty, walled front garden, driveway for two cars in front of the garage and open access around the side to an extensive lawned garden with small outbuilding and views over the neighbouring fields towards the Pennines. Sold with no onward chain viewing is essential to fully appreciate all that this wonderful home has to offer.
